OK, so I am pickin up the parts to get ready for the 4 wheel disc conversion on my 70 40. I met a guy that has built a bracket that will mount Toyota calipers for the back. He has 4 piston on the front and 2 piston on the rear and he says that you don't need a porportioning valve if you do the set up that way. Is this true or do you think that it might just be for his rig. He runs 44's and I got 31's. I am also gonna go with the S-10 master from the tech section like Mike Smythe. Also any thoughts on going with 2 versus 4 piston on the rear?

Let the stock piling begin.....

I'm just going through the nightmare of fixing a 4 wheel disc job a shop did for me. My kit has Monte Carlo rear disc brakes (using a conversion bracket) and an whole front axle from a late 70's FJ40. The back is one really big piston while the front is really small four piston. With the stock proportioning valve my back brakes lock early.

I don't know about Toyota back brakes but if you are using the front axle setup I have, get calipers from a 92 4Runner which has much bigger pistons. You will need to grind the backing plate a little and maybe grind off some of the cooling fins on the calipers to make them not hit the wheel but it is worth the trouble.

A proprtioning valve is only $40 at summit racing and it will let you fine tune your brakes to work the way you want so I stongly recommend it.

Don't forget to take the residual valves out of your master cyl!

I also have a disc brake booster with a late 70's master cyl but you can give your existing master cyl a try to see if everything works to your satisfaction.

Curious what Toyota caliper has 2 pistons, a 2WD Toy truck front? A rear toyota caliper is usually a single piston, floating caliper design much like a Chevy design, just smaller. The only problem is often the caliper is designed for much smaller diameter rotors. Guys use ventilated 6 lugs rotors from Chevy truck fronts for cruiser conversion, but may be you can look at other 6-lug Japanese small truck/SUV front rotors e.g. Amigo, B2000. etc. for a smaller diameter one.

IMO most of braking power is from the front brakes anyway (assuming forward motion :) ) so going big on the rear is not helping that much unless you go bigger up front like Scott says.

The adjustable prop valve is about $40 at Summit or Jegs. The 4 piston caliper will work fine, I run them in the back too with the '92 4Runner calipers up front so there is still more braking force up front than the back.

Just curious if you want all Toyota calipers, why you want an Chevy S-10 master cylinder. You can get 1" bore 4WDB master cylinder off a 1993-94 FZJ80 that will bolt up to your Toyota booster. It will move plenty of volume. What is the bore on the S-10 master cyl?
